I'm not sure if this is possible already(I can't find a way to make it work if it is) - but it would be a nice to have this feature in the future.

When in drafting and you want to dimension from a datum plane for example that is outside the boundary of the view, you either have to: expand in, figure out the layer of the feature and make it visible make your first pick for the dimension, expand back out then make the second pick, or you can expand in make the datum visible and use the name selection to pick it, expand back out, then make the second pick.

This seems like a very lengthy process - it would be nice if you could just use the name selection bar without having to expand in the view - Exactly how a cylindrical dimension works when you have the "use base line" option picked.
